首页>>数据库>>Oracle->mysql创建表转为oracle,mysql转成oracle

mysql创建表转为oracle,mysql转成oracle

时间:2023-12-28 本站 点击:0

如何将MySql数据导入至Oracle中

1、.自动增长的数据类型处理 MYSQL有自动增长的数据类型,插入记录时不用操作此字段,会自动获得数据值。ORACLE没有自动增长的数据类型,需要建立一个自动增长的序列号,插入记录时要把序列号的下一个值赋于此字段。

2、将数据从MySQL迁移到Oracle的注意事项,有如下几点 1.自动增长的数据类型处理 MYSQL有自动增长的数据类型,插入记录时不用操作此字段,会自动获得数据值。

3、下面这段视频演示了通过Oracle SQL Developer将MySQL中的数据库导入Oracle的过程。

怎么将mysql存储过程转换成oracle存储过程

1、可以选择开源的Kettle(ETL工具),可以定时导入,也可以手动导入。自己到官网下载一个。mysql和oracle的数据类型不同,这个工具可以自动给你转换成ORACLE的数据类型,如果不是很准确,还能自行修改,还可以浏览生成的数据。

2、oracle中的concat只支持两个参数,会报参数个数错误,替换成下面的 or 注意,mysql中不支持用 || 的模糊查询 mysql中的别名可以使用uid,但是uid在oracle中是一个保留关键字。

3、GROUP_CONCAT 改成wm_concat 试一下,其它的好像都能用 注意wm_concat是有使用权限问题的 还有就是这个函数返回的是clob 对应mysql里的text类型。程序里使用要用to_char 转换一下。

mysql和oracle之间的几个步骤转换

1、选“Using script files”,点下侧的添加按钮,添加XXX.sql文件,然后选择“确定 ”。

2、点击开始,进行表转换 对于其他表,在转换成mysql后,确认一下表中数据id的最大值,将最大值+1作为新表序列的current_value。然后自定义序列名,最好与原序列名称保持一致,执行步骤4。

3、将数据移植到 Oracle 细粒度移植 复杂对象移植支持存储过程、触发器和视图。

4、字段1~N是你要导入的MySql的表字段数据,不需要的字段可以不写。用Sqlldr导入文本 c:\sqlldr ora_usr 回车后输入控制文件的路径,密码,接下来加载控制文件自动导入。

5、你可以用工具 我给你建议一个开源的图像化界面的工具 kettle,这个工具使用简单可以做抽取和转换,而且支持很多的数据库。

6、视图定义基本都是iso标准,mysql和oracle基本没有区别,因此可以直接使用mysql的视图创建语句直接在oracle 中创建。

有自动把mysql转换到oracle的工具?

1、运行MySQL Migration Toolkit,一路“Next”到“Source Database”,在Database System中选择Oracle Database Server,如果第一次使用会告之要求加载驱动程序ojdbc1jar。

2、有一个转换工具Convert Mysql to Oracle。你百度下怎么用。至于不同库有相同表的问题,没有什么好办法,除非另见一个用户,把相同表明的表放进去。

3、有一个工具是mysql到oracle做数据迁移的叫Convert Mysql to Oracle 你可以试试,不知道合不合适。非要弄shell的话,那可真是麻烦可以选择让程序员写个小程序转换sql的让后用shell调用。真自己写shell。。

怎么样把Mysql的数据库转换成Oracle类型的数据库

1、加载驱动程序之后,界面将变成如下的形式,在其中填写Oracle数据库的连接信息,按“Next”继续。

2、可以选择开源的Kettle(ETL工具),可以定时导入,也可以手动导入。自己到官网下载一个。mysql和oracle的数据类型不同,这个工具可以自动给你转换成ORACLE的数据类型,如果不是很准确,还能自行修改,还可以浏览生成的数据。

3、注意:OGG在Oracle迁移MySQL的场景下不支持DDL语句同步,因此表结构迁移完成后到数据库切换前尽量不要再修改表结构。

4、MYSQL中用LOGTEXT表示oracle中的CLOB类型。Oracle CLOB Oracle 9i 及以前,最大4G字符数据 Oracle10g 最大4G*数据库块大小的字符数据 MySQL LONGTEXT 最大长度为4,294,967,295或4GB(232–1)字符的TEXT列。

5、而pathtochk则是myisamchk所在的位置,DATA_DIR是你的MySQL数据库存放的位置。

关于mysql创建表转为oracle和mysql转成oracle的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/oracle/70798.html